Ive accidentally put unleaded petrol in my diesel engine!?

Only£5 of unleaded, and then £20 of diesel on top - will that be enough to dilute the damage?

Answers:
Most diesels will tolerate up to about 20% dilution with petrol with little ill effect. In some extremely cold areas, diesel is cut with petrol to improve cold flow characteristics. It seldom gets cold enough in the UK for this to be done -- note the number of lorrys along the roadside on the rare occasion when temps drop below -15C -- so your diesel is probably pure to begin with.

I'd contact a dealer to be sure. At the very least, if the 20 quids worth didn't top up the tank, I'd top it off with diesel just to be safe.

The petrol may loosen up some swarf from the fuel system so it would not be a bad idea to have the fuel filters changed. Also, petrol is more likely to have small amounts of entrained water dissolved in it so it would be a good idea to drain the fuel filters if they're designed to do so. Water is bad in petrol engines but it's death to a diesel.

Do not take the chance. You may cause catastrophic damage to your engine.
Try to drain all the fuel from the tank and fuel system, before refilling with a fresh batch of diesel.
The dilution factor you mention may on the surface, seem to be a reasonable assumption, but diesel and petrol do not instantly mix into a homognous fluid, and if you get a few seconds of pure petrol going through the diesel pump and being burned by the engine, It is enough to permanently wreck your poor engine.
Note: Diesel into petrol only causes the engine to come to a stuttering halt at high percentages of diesel into the petrol.
